Cheese Fondue (Food Network Kitchens) |
|
 |
Prep Time: 5 Minutes Cook Time: 15 Minutes |
Ready In: 20 Minutes Servings: 2 |
|
Ingredients:
12 ounces gruyere cheese, shredded (about 4 cups) |
4 ounces sharp cheddar cheese, shredded (about 1 cup) |
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our |
1 clove garlic, halved |
1 cup dry white wine |
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ice |
2 teaspoons dijon mustard |
1/4 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g (optional) |
assorted dippers, for serving |
Directions:
1. Toss the cheeses with the flour in a bowl. Rub the inside of a saucepan with the cut sides of the garlic; discard the garlic. 2. Whisk the wine, lemon juice and mustard in the saucepan and bring to a gentle simmer over medium heat. Add half of the cheese mixture and stir with a wooden spoon until melted. Add the remaining cheese mixture and stir until smooth; add the nutmeg. 3. Continue to cook, stirring, 2 more minutes. Transfer to a fondue pot or slow cooker to keep warm. Serve with your choice of dippers. 4. Try these unlikely dippers: 5. Iceberg lettuce 6. Dried figs 7. Pasta 8. Avocado 9. Pearl onions (blanched) 10. Mini hot dogs 11. Candied walnuts 12. Gherkins 13. Pineapple 14. Popcorn 15. Bacon 16. Shredded wheat 17. Mini bagels 18. Butternut squash (roasted) 19. Celery 20. Corn on the cob 21. Croissants 22. Grapes 23. Beef jerky |
